This innovation combines aesthetic design with increased recyclability.<\/strong><\/p>\n<p>The importance of sustainability in product design is constantly increasing, and the challenge of designing recyclable materials in an aesthetically pleasing way remains. In particular <strong>Metal effect pigments<\/strong>, which are known for their attractive design, often cause <strong>Problems in recycling plants<\/strong>. These pigments can make it difficult to recognise plastics using NIR, as they absorb the wavelengths in a similar way to black plastics and packaging and hinder sorting.<\/p>\n<p><a href=\"https:\/\/packaging-journal.de\/?s=Lifocolor\">Lifocolour<\/a>, a leading supplier of masterbatch solutions, has developed a new masterbatch solution in collaboration with the pigment manufacturer <a href=\"https:\/\/packaging-journal.de\/?s=Eckart&amp;cat=-1&amp;date-all=all&amp;begin=&amp;end=\">Eckart<\/a> has developed an innovative solution that addresses this problem. Conventional metal pigments, however, act as microscopic mirrors and scattering centres in this process, which weakens the reflected NIR signal and makes it difficult or even impossible to detect the plastics.<\/p>\n<figure id=\"attachment_94990\" aria-describedby=\"caption-attachment-94990\" style=\"width: 1200px\" class=\"wp-caption aligncenter\"><img fetchpriority=\"high\" decoding=\"async\" class=\"wp-image-94990 size-full\" src=\"https:\/\/packaging-journal.de\/wp-content\/uploads\/2024\/08\/lifecolor-silber-batch.jpg\" alt=\"\" width=\"1200\" height=\"650\" srcset=\"https:\/\/packaging-journal.de\/wp-content\/uploads\/2024\/08\/lifecolor-silber-batch.jpg 1200w, https:\/\/packaging-journal.de\/wp-content\/uploads\/2024\/08\/lifecolor-silber-batch-300x163.jpg 300w, https:\/\/packaging-journal.de\/wp-content\/uploads\/2024\/08\/lifecolor-silber-batch-1024x555.jpg 1024w, https:\/\/packaging-journal.de\/wp-content\/uploads\/2024\/08\/lifecolor-silber-batch-768x416.jpg 768w\" sizes=\"(max-width: 1200px) 100vw, 1200px\" \/><figcaption id=\"caption-attachment-94990\" class=\"wp-caption-text\">(Image: Lifocolor)<\/figcaption><\/figure>\n<p>Through a targeted selection and combination of effect pigments, Eckart has succeeded in developing a series of silver pigments that are both <strong>Visually appealing and highly NIR-detectable<\/strong> are. These pigments have been specially designed to meet the requirements of modern recycling plants and the automatic sorting of plastics.<\/p>\n<p>Lifocolor is now using these new pigments for its masterbatch products and emphasises that the NIR-detectable silver masterbatches have not only been developed for all common polymers and processing methods, but also for the <strong>Contact with food<\/strong> are authorised in accordance with EU Directive 10\/2011 and FDA. In cooperation with a leading recycling company, four different formulations for HDPE (high-density polyethylene) and PP (polypropylene) were successfully tested for their sortability.<\/p>\n<p>According to Lifocolor, this development makes it possible to <strong>Requirements for sustainable product design and effective recycling<\/strong> to be better combined.
